Lionel Messi crowned GOAT over Cristiano Ronaldo by CR7’s ex-Manchester United teammate due to World Cup win

Lionel Messi and Cristiano Ronaldo are two of the best players to ever grace a soccer pitch. The debate of who is the better soccer player is never-ending. Even people who don’t follow soccer debate over who is the better player. Many celebrities, personalities, and even former players sometimes weigh in their opinion. 

The latest player to put in his opinion on the debate is a bit surprising. He is Kieran Richardson, who used to be one of Cristiano Ronaldo’s teammates at Manchester United. He played 40 matches with the Portuguese during his spell with the Red Devils from 2002 to 2007. His choice between the two GOATs was rather surprising as he chose Messi over his former teammate.

What did Kieran say regarding the GOAT debate?

He said it on a podcast, The Steven Sulley Study, “They’re both the GOATs. But if I had to pick one, then I have to pick Messi, even though I know Ronaldo, I’ve played with Ronaldo, and I love Ronaldo.”

He explained his decision came down to Messi winning the World Cup, “When they pass away, they’ll still be talked about forever, but just because Messi got that World Cup. It’s a massive thing having that World Cup because even before Messi had the World Cup, everyone was saying, yeah, but he hasn’t won it yet. He can’t be the best of all time because [Diego] Maradona won it, Pele won it.”

“Now there is no question; he’s won the pinnacle any footballer would want to win. Even though they get their own accolades, World Player of the Year so many times, as a footballer, when you’re thinking as a kid, you want to win a World Cup. That’s all you want to win.”

What now for Lionel Messi and Cristiano Ronaldo? 

Lionel Messi achieved one of his greatest feats when he led Argentina to a World Cup victory last year. He inspired passion in the team and was the Best Player at the tournament with seven goals. Messi then went on to win FIFA’s The Best award for his brilliant year. This season with Paris Saint Germain, he has 13 goals and 13 assists in Ligue 1, though they were knocked out of the Champions League again after losing 3-0 aggregate to Bayern Munich.

Lionel Messi is also rumored to want a move away from PSG, with Barcelona and Inter Miami as his next likely destinations.

Ronaldo meanwhile signed a massive contract with Saudi Arabian club Al-Nassr after leaving Manchester United due to a controversial interview with Piers Morgan in November. He became the world’s highest-paid player and has since enjoyed a lot of freedom in the new country.

Cristiano had a dream start to life and scored eight goals, including two hat tricks in the Saudi Pro League. He even won the player of the Month award for February for his eight goals and two assists. His team is now second behind league leaders Al Ittihad after a 1-0 loss last Thursday.
